- 浏览: 99430 次
-
最新评论
文章列表
Linux是个人计算机和工作站上的Unix类操作系统。但是,它绝不是简化的Unix。相反,Linux是强有力和具有创新意义的Unix类操作系统。它不仅继承了Unix的特征,而且在许多方面超过了Unix。作为Unix类操作系统,Linux内核具有下列基本特征:
1. Linux内核的组织形式为整体式结构。也就是说整个Linux内 核由很多过程组成,每个过程可以独立编译,然后用连接程序将其连接在一起成为一个单独的目标程序。从信息隐藏的观点看,她没有任何程度的隐藏—每个过程都 对其它过程可见。这种结构的最大特点是内部结构简单,子系统间易于访问,因此内核的工作效率较高。另外,基于过程的结构也有助于 ...
- 2013-04-08 19:47
- 浏览 465
- 评论(0)
task_struct结构描述
1.
进程状态(State)
进程执行时,它会根据具体情况改变状态。进程状态是调度和对换的依据。Linux中的进程主要有如下状态,如表4.1所示。
表4.1 Linux进程的状态
内核表示
含义
TASK_RUNNING
可运行
TASK_INTERRUPTIBLE
可中断的等待状态
TASK_UNINTERRUPTIBLE
不可中断的等待状态
TASK_ZOMBIE
僵死
TASK_STOPPED
暂停
...
- 2013-04-08 19:42
- 浏览 455
- 评论(0)
日期函数:
1、求某天是星期几
select to_char(to_date('2002-08-26','yyyy-mm-dd'),'day') from dual;星期一
select to_char(to_date('2002-08-26','yyyy-mm-dd'),'day','NLS_DATE_LANGUAGE = American') from dual;
monday设置日期语言
ALTER SESSION SET NLS_DATE_LANGUAGE='AMERICAN';也可以这样
TO_DATE ('2002-08-26', 'YYYY-mm-dd', 'NLS_D ...
- 2013-04-08 19:30
- 浏览 431
- 评论(0)
八、 应用实例
下面以电算部开发出之程序<<MDS展开及开工日维护程序>>之各类程序为例:
1. Create table, index, sequence, table trigger
首先清除原先已有之重名table,Sequence等:
DROP TABLE ZDL_BKC_JOB_BODY;
DROP TABLE ZDL_BKC_JOB_HEAD;
DROP TABLE ZDL_BKC_JOB_UPDATE;
drop sequence zdl_bkc_job_s;
建立table, sequence以及Index
create table ...
- 2013-04-08 19:30
- 浏览 520
- 评论(0)
第二部分 PL/SQL语法部分
一、 PL/SQL语言简介
(本讲义之所有程序均调式通过)
首先我们看一个简单之例子,下面这个例子是统计从1至100的总和.
declare
i number:=0; /*声明变量井给初值*/
t number:=1;
error_message exception; /*声明一个出错处理*/
begin
for t in 1..100 loop
i:=i+t;
end loop;
if i>=5050 then
raise error_message; /*引发错误处理*/
else
insert into ...
- 2013-04-08 19:29
- 浏览 294
- 评论(0)
4. 数值函数
4.1. 函數:ABS
语法:
ABS(number)
用途:
该函数返回数值number的绝对值.绝对值就是一个数去掉符号的那部分.
4.2. 函數:SQRT
语法:
SQRT(number)
用途:
该函数返回数值number的平方根,输入值必须大于等于0,否则返回 ...
- 2013-04-08 19:28
- 浏览 342
- 评论(0)
1.3. 函數:TO_DATE
语法:
TO_DATE(string,format)
用途:
根据给定的格式将一个字符串转换成Oracle的日期值.
该函数的主要用途是用来验证输入的日期值.在应用程序中,用户必须验证输入日期是否有效,如月份是否在1~12之间和日期中的天数是否在指定月份的天数内.
1.4. 函數:TO_NUMBER
语法:
TO_NUMBER(string[,format])
用途:
该函数将一个字符串转换成相应的数值.对于简单的字符串转换数值(例如几位数字加上小数点).格式是可选的.
2. 日期函数
2.1 ...
- 2013-04-08 19:27
- 浏览 348
- 评论(0)
SQL PL/SQL语法
目 录
第一部分 SQL语法部分................................................................................................................................................. 3
一、
CREATE TABLE 语句........................................................................................... ...
- 2013-04-08 19:26
- 浏览 423
- 评论(0)
Oracle
2.1 oracle用户卸载时被占用,怎么找到是谁占用
主题:oracle用户卸载时被占用,怎么找到是谁(session)占用
在卸载oracle用户时,发现用户被占用,一般情况可以很顺利的解决:
查询某用户会话session
SQL> select sid,serial#,status,server from v$session where username='ENIPDBZQ';
SID SERIAL# STATUS SERVER
---------- ---------- -------- ---------
348 21909 INACTIVE ...
- 2013-04-02 19:55
- 浏览 413
- 评论(0)
(25) 关闭磁盘
关闭磁盘命令如下:
# vxdisk offline devicename
命令参数说明如表11-22所示。
启动磁盘命令参数说明
参数名称
参数说明
devicename
指定需要关闭的磁盘对应的LUN名称。
(26) 重命名diskname
重命名diskname命令如下:
# vxedit -g dgname rename oldname newname
命令参数说明如表11-23所示。
重命名磁盘名称命令参数说明
参数
说明
-g
指定DG名称。
rename
重命名磁盘。
oldname
待修改的磁盘名称。
newna ...
- 2013-04-02 19:53
- 浏览 884
- 评论(0)
一 SYSTEM
1.1 Linux常用命令
压缩 tar –cvf jrm.tar JAVA
解tar.gz tar xvzf 包名
解tar.bz2 tar jxvf 包名
解tar.gz包:gzip -cd ENIP_V100R004C52CP0001_BMP_RUN.tar.gz | tar -xvf –
gzip -dc manager.tar.gz |tar xvf - *.jpg(解所有jpg文件)
gzip -dc youyou.tar.gz |tar xvf - youyou/9sky/(解9sky目录)
unzip abc.zip 解zip包
rpm – ...
- 2013-04-02 19:52
- 浏览 459
- 评论(0)
/**
*
*/
package iSword;
import java.util.Date;
import java.util.Scanner;
/**
* 计算今天是今年的第多少天
* author 东海 陈光剑 chenguangjian
* Email: universsky@126.com
* Blog: http://blog.sina.com.cn/universsky11
* http://blog.csdn.net/universsky
*
*/
public class d ...
- 2013-04-02 19:17
- 浏览 2638
- 评论(0)
日志概念及作用
日志是记录系统运行过程中各种重要信息的文件,在系统运行过程中由各进程创建并记录。
日志的作用是记录系统的运行过程及异常信息,为快速定位系统运行中出现的问题及开发过程中的程序调试问题提供详 ...
- 2013-04-02 18:30
- 浏览 423
- 评论(0)
性能测试管理
性能管理的目的是:收集数据,评价网络资源(包括物理资源和逻辑资源)的使用情况,尽早定位潜在的问题,并支持网络规划、分析及优化,从而改进网络性能的表现和效率;保障网络能提供良好的服务质量。
...
- 2013-04-02 18:29
- 浏览 432
- 评论(0)